**Leadership Review Briefing — Annual Billing Shift**

Quick one for finance: we're proposing moving Bramblewick customers from monthly to annual billing starting next quarter. Early modeling by Tessa's team shows better cash predictability and lower churn on the Lumenpad tier. Dunning costs should drop too. We'll walk through the transition mechanics Thursday. The strategic rationale is summarized below.

internal memo for fahif-bawip: Headcount on the Ralael team goes from 48 to 96 by the end of December. Gross margin on Ralael came in at 14 percent against a plan of 3 percent.

Quarterly Planning Note — Pilot Churn Update

Hi all — for branch managers running the Quillmere pilot: churn hit 11% last quarter, a bit worse than hoped, mostly among customers who joined during the summer promo. We're tweaking the welcome journey and adding a 60-day check-in call, which Renwick's branch trialled with good results. Expect updated scripts by mid-month, and please log cancellation reasons properly this time. Before you brief your teams, read the note below.

board note of kageg-bahof: The renewal with Holwynax Holdings closes at $2 million a year, 5 percent below the last contract. Project Ulaath slips by two quarters because of the supplier delay.

# Nudgecall Environments

Welcome aboard. Nudgecall is the reminder job that texts patients of the Ferncroft clinics ahead of appointments. There are three environments: dev (synthetic patient data only), staging (mirrors schedules nightly), and prod. Never point dev at a real messaging gateway. Each environment reads one settings bundle at startup; the staging bundle, which you'll use first, contains the following values.

deployment values, yadug-bawif:
[framir]
team = pelox
access_code = ac_a38ab2
owner = tamion.julael
host = framir.tolvaqlabs.test
port = 11211
peer = tammir.zemvargrid.local
salt = 2215ef03
pin = 1541

Subject: DR drill Friday — docs linter

Welcome aboard. Friday we run the quarterly disaster-recovery drill for Inkhound, our documentation linter. Scenario: primary rule-set store is gone. Your job: restore the rules bundle from cold storage, rerun the linter against the Marrowgate docs repo, confirm zero spurious failures. Timebox: two hours. Everything you need is in the drill folder except the restore credential. The cold-storage restore prompt asks for the recovery passphrase, which appears on the line below.

unlock words, hahip-baduf: holwyn-istath-julvan